opencv-rust compatability #130

Rust's opencv bindings used to just work with rusty_ffmpeg, but switching from 0.14 to 0.15 breaks linking.

Adding this line to any Cargo.toml using rusty_ffmpeg v0.15+ causes this issue:

opencv = { version = "0.93.1", default-features = false, features = ["clang-runtime"] }
/usr/bin/ld: /workspaces/myproject/ffmpeg/./libavutil/timestamp.h:76: undefined reference to `av_ts_make_time_string2'

Tested with FFmpeg 7.0 and 7.1
